从teradata表加载数据行到mysql表

时间:2014-02-27 09:17:47

标签: mysql teradata

我们需要将teradata表中的数据行加载到mysql表中 关于我如何开始的任何暗示? canfastexport(或任何其他实用程序)帮助?

提前谢谢你:)

1 个答案:

答案 0 :(得分:1)

根据您所谈论的数据量,您有以下几种选择:

  1. BTEQ 可用于导出中小型数据卷,并使用一些狡猾的SQL创建使用连接的分隔文件。
  2. FastExport 有多种风格,您可以在其中调用它以将数据从Teradata导出到平面文件。 Teradata Studio和Studio Express应支持基于JDBC的FastExports,它可以支持中等到大的数据量。您在Teradata和桌面之间的带宽将决定实际可行性。利用Teradata CLI的标准FastExport实用程序是从数据库中获取数据的最快方法,应该保留用于大型数据集,因为小数据集的开销超过了速度优势。
  3. Teradata Parallel Transport 是Teradata传统MultiLoad / FastLoad / FastExport工具的替代工具套件。有几个运算符,如STREAM,允许您将数据从数据库提取到平面文件。
  4. 利用企业ETL工具,它将使用Teradata的FastExport或Teradata并行传输API将数据提取到中间层,然后通过映射使用适当的MySQL工具将数据加载到MySQL中( s)将数据放在登台表或目标表中。